Jan 19, 2026 Rick Wilson, a political strategist and co-founder of The Lincoln Project, and Laura Jedeed, a freelance journalist specializing in immigration issues, dive into provocative discussions about Trump's controversial policies. Wilson critiques the Trump-era 'Board of Peace' shakedown scheme and the Republican health plan’s shortcomings. Jedeed shares shocking insights from her experience at an ICE hiring expo, revealing disturbing vetting practices that raise safety concerns. Together, they highlight the implications of irresponsible governance in America today.

Personal Grievance Drives Policy
- Donald Trump's Minnesota action is driven by personal grievance and algorithmic feedback loops rather than policy goals.
- Molly Jong Fast argues this emboldens reckless actions that alienate independents and harm national stability.
State Action Reflects ICE Unpopularity
- Abigail Spanberger ended Virginia's participation in local-ICE collaboration on day one as a political calculation.
- Rick Wilson says ICE's unpopularity pushes centrists toward abolition-style reforms.
Policy As A Profit Scheme
- Rick Wilson frames Trump's 'Board of Peace' and other initiatives as financial shakedowns rather than legitimate policy.
- He says Trump treats everything as a racket, monetizing national actions for personal gain.
